Responsibilities

  • Safely drives residents to medical appointments, outings, and other destinations according to assigned schedule
  • Adheres to traffic laws, regulations, and facility policies to ensure the safety of passengers and others on the road
  • Assists residents into and out of vehicle
  • Secures passengers’ wheelchairs to restraining devices to stabilize wheelchairs while driving
  • Communicate effectively with residents, families, and staff to coordinate transportation schedules and ensure resident needs are met
  • Communicates with administrative staff regularly to receive instructions or report delays and disruptions of service
  • Maintains the cleanliness and safety of the vehicle, performing routine inspections, refueling and immediately reporting maintenance needs
  • Keeps records of trips and behavior of passengers
